This 2 DVD set features Edgar Sulite and his practical self-defense instruction in Lameco Eskrima.
Part 1 covers defense against a knife attacker, beginning with basic footwork and stick-based defenses. Edgar also demonstrates how a tennis racquet, umbrella, handkerchief, and belt can be used in place of the stick. Approx. 50 minutes. 1994.
Part 2 continues the knife-defense lesson with empty-hand counters based on Lameco Eskrima principles, including footwork review, knife redirection methods, disarms, and self-defense techniques for common hold-up situations. 50 minutes.
The late Punong Guro Edgar Sulite developed Lameco Eskrima from extensive training in the Philippines and the United States, creating a system that addresses long, middle, and close ranges. This release is digitally remastered from the original videocassette master.
